Why Preparation Matters Before an Oxygen Facial

An Oxygen facial is designed to deliver oxygen along with skin-friendly ingredients to the surface of the skin. Preparing beforehand helps remove factors that may interfere with product absorption and allows skincare professionals to assess your skin more accurately.

Good preparation may also help:

Keep the skin surface clean
Reduce temporary sensitivity
Improve the even application of skincare products
Allow better evaluation of your skin's current condition

Know Your Current Skin Condition

Before scheduling an Oxygen facial, take note of how your skin has been behaving over the previous few days. Skin can change due to weather, hormones, travel, or skincare products.

Pay attention to:

Dry or flaky patches
Active breakouts
Redness or irritation
Areas with increased oil production
Recent allergic reactions

This information helps determine whether your skin is ready for treatment or whether certain skincare products should be avoided beforehand.

Keep Your Skin Clean

Clean skin provides an ideal surface for an Oxygen facial. On the day of your appointment, wash your face using a gentle cleanser that removes dirt, oil, and sunscreen without disrupting the skin barrier.

Choose products that:

Are fragrance-free if your skin is sensitive
Do not contain harsh exfoliating ingredients
Leave the skin feeling comfortable instead of tight

Avoid applying heavy creams or thick makeup immediately before your session unless instructed otherwise.

Avoid Strong Exfoliating Products

Several skincare ingredients can temporarily increase skin sensitivity. It is generally recommended to pause strong exfoliating products before an Oxygen facial.

These may include:

Retinoids

Chemical exfoliants such as AHAs or BHAs
High-strength exfoliating scrubs
Products containing strong peeling acids

Giving your skin time to settle helps maintain a balanced skin surface before treatment.

Stay Well Hydrated

Hydrated skin often appears smoother and more comfortable. Drinking enough water supports overall skin health and complements a consistent skincare routine.

While hydration alone does not replace professional skincare, maintaining healthy water intake is a simple step that contributes to normal skin function.

Protect Your Skin From Excess Sun Exposure

Sun exposure can leave the skin more sensitive than usual. If possible, limit prolonged exposure before your appointment.

Helpful habits include:

Wearing sunscreen daily
Using a wide-brimmed hat outdoors
Seeking shade during peak sunlight hours
Avoiding intentional tanning before treatment

Healthy skin is generally more comfortable during cosmetic skincare procedures.

Skip Harsh Cosmetic Procedures

If you have recently undergone another cosmetic treatment, allow your skin enough recovery time before having an Oxygen facial.

Examples include:

Chemical peels
Laser procedures
Microneedling
Deep exfoliation treatments

Spacing treatments appropriately helps avoid unnecessary skin irritation and allows the skin to recover naturally.

Share Your Skincare Routine

Your skincare routine provides valuable information about your skin's needs. Before the appointment, be prepared to discuss:

Daily cleansers
Moisturizers
Active ingredients
Sunscreen products
Recent skincare changes

Knowing what products you regularly use helps skincare professionals recommend suitable preparation guidelines.

What to Bring to Your Appointment

Preparing ahead makes the visit more convenient.

Consider bringing:

A list of your skincare products
Information about any known skin sensitivities
Hair ties or clips if needed
Minimal makeup for easier cleansing

These small preparations can help make the appointment more efficient.

Common Mistakes to Avoid Before an Oxygen Facial

Many people unknowingly follow habits that may not be ideal before treatment.

Avoid:

Trying new skincare products immediately beforehand
Over-cleansing your face
Excessive scrubbing
Picking at blemishes
Forgetting sunscreen during the days leading up to the appointment

Keeping your skincare routine simple often helps maintain the skin's natural balance.

What Happens After Preparation?

Once your skin is properly prepared, the Oxygen facial typically begins with cleansing followed by the application of oxygen and specialized skincare formulations designed to refresh the skin's surface. The exact process may vary depending on individual skin needs and the products selected for the session.

Because the skin has already been cared for before treatment, skincare products can usually be applied to a clean and balanced surface throughout the procedure.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I wear makeup before an Oxygen facial?

It is generally better to arrive with clean skin or minimal makeup, allowing the cleansing step to be more efficient.

Should I stop using retinol before an Oxygen facial?

Many skincare professionals recommend pausing strong active ingredients such as retinoids for a short period before treatment to reduce potential sensitivity.

Is sunscreen important before an Oxygen facial?

Yes. Daily sunscreen use helps protect the skin from UV exposure and supports healthy skin before cosmetic skincare treatments.

Can I have an Oxygen facial if I have sensitive skin?

Many individuals with sensitive skin may be suitable candidates, although preparation recommendations can vary depending on the condition of the skin.
